Argyle calls special meeting to keep new mayor out of files?

June 2, 2011 By TXsharon

Something crazy is going on in Argyle. Yesterday a notice of a special meeting was posted. The purpose of the meeting seems to be to limit the powers of the new mayor and limit his access to records.

  1. Discuss, consider, and act on adoption or amendment of Town Ordinances regarding the role(s) and responsibility(ies)of the Town Manager and the Mayor.
  2. Discuss, consider, and act on the provision of records and/or access to Town staff by the Mayor and Town Council.

Why would they want to do that? Is this even legal?

Maybe THIS is why.
